Giving In

Dooley's Clone Lives at Kitty Hawk Kites in Nags Head

Well ... we have tried our best to not make Dooley, our English Bulldog puppy, the center of our universe, but as you can see with our creation of a blog...I think it is safe to say that we have given in. Seems to be the case with most of the situations Courtney and I find ourselves in with our dog. "Giving in" seems to be the daily routine for us.

I have always wanted an English Bulldog, and I am sure that every first-time English Bulldog owner says, "Our bulldog won't be that unhealthy, ours wont cost that much money, and ours wont be that stubborn." Well, I am here to tell you that nothing can quite prepare you for how much of a handful they can be. To be perfectly honest, as I am writing this post, Dooley is actually eating the chair that I am sitting in. I'm not that upset, its another one of those things that we seem to have "given in" to. Seems the will-power and stubbornness of an English Bulldog can outlast that of a young married couple. Oh well, we would not trade her for the world. Sure she eats walls, chairs, rocks, and pretty much anything within a 3ft radius of her mouth, but she is the funniest little character I know.

Seems that Dooley has something that is worthy of sharing with the world everyday, so we will do our best to share. Check back soon!

P.S. The picture is from a few months ago, but I wanted to share. Probably one of our favorite pictures of the dog. If any of you did not know, Dooley's clone lives at the Kitty Hawk Kites Nags Head store.
